X687 DDP is a 2000 Fiat Punto 1.2 in Grey with a 1,242c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 53.3%.
Across all 2000 Fiat Punto 1.2 models, the average MOT pass rate is 66.1% with a typical mileage of 66,188 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Fiat Punto 1.2 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 2,319 recorded failures. If you're considering buying X687 DDP,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Fiat Punto 1.2 typically stays on UK roads for around 26 years. At 26 years old, this Fiat Punto 1.2 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
